Abstract (in English)
Altogether 341 species of true bugs (Hemiptera: Heteroptera) are here reported from the Czech part of the Jizerské hory Mts, which represents 39 % of all Heteroptera species known from the Czech Republic. Among them, 325 species have been recorded recently within surveys conducted in 2004–2019. Three more species are known from the Polish part of the area. Three species, Dicyphus josifovi, Nysius cymoides and Tytthus pubescens are reported here for the first time from Bohemia. Thirty three species registered in the area under study are listed in the Red List of Invertebrates of the Czech Republic. The rediscovery of the regionally extinct Shore Bug Micracanthia marginalis is the most notable, as well as new records of several other rare species: Lamproplax picea, Peritrechus angusticollis, Cryptostemma cf. remanei, Aradu s obtectus, Euryopicoris nitidus, Fieberocapsus flaveolus, Globiceps juniperi, Notonecta obliqua, Salda muelleri, Teratocoris paludum or Macrodema microptera.
